9. What is the RGB code of Tenné (Tawny) color?
The hex code #cd5700 corresponds to the RGB value rgb(205, 87, 0).
+
10. What is the HSV value of Tenné (Tawny) color?
In HSV (Hue, Saturation, Value) format, the Tenné (Tawny) color is represented as hsv(25, 100%, 80%).
+
11. What is the HSL code of Tenné (Tawny) color?
The H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) format for Tenné (Tawny) is hsl(25, 100%, 40%).
+
12. What is the CMYK value of Tenné (Tawny) color for printing?
The print-friendly CMYK value for Tenné (Tawny) is cmyk(0%, 58%, 100%, 20%).
